DDO50 Victoria Street East Ends

Victoria Street East is located on Victoria Street between Church Street and Davison Street. It does not include land zoned residential between Johnson and Leslie Streets or land east of Grosvenor Street which is covered by other planning controls.  

The precinct includes a mix of shops, large format retail, cafes and restaurants, offices and apartment buildings. The precinct abuts both residential and industrial land.

 

 

Through draft Amendment C291yara, Yarra City Council is proposing to apply a new Design and Development Overlay - Schedule 50 (DDO50) to Victoria Street East Ends.  

DDO50 would replace an interim DDO, DDO22, which applies to this precinct and the rest of Victoria Street. 

Built form and design requirements in the DDO relate to front setbacks, street wall height, setbacks for upper levels, building height and transition of potential development towards residential properties at the rear. The DDO also includes requirements and guidelines regarding overshadowing, facade design, transport and access and others.

The amendment also includes new policy which describes the proposed future character of Victoria Street East Ends (see Clause 21.11 – Local Areas).

What is this Design and Development Overlay trying to achieve?

Draft Design and Development Overlay – Schedule 50 (DDO50) generally supports new mid-rise development up to 7 storeys that creates taller buildings along Victoria Street.

In this area, as there is no defining heritage streetscape, a new character would be created. Lower building heights of 5 storeys apply closer to Church Street to match heights to the west. 

The height of street wall (the height of the building on the street) could be up to 15m (4 storeys). Taller parts of the building above 4 storeys would be pushed back by 4.5 metres.

For any heritage buildings in the precinct, a greater upper level setback is required to ensure the prominence of these buildings.

DDO50 requires that on larger sites, buildings are designed with breaks between upper levels of the development to provide views to the sky from the street and an interesting skyline.

Under the DDO50, development should be designed to create safe, active and attractive street frontages. Development must be designed to protect sunlight to Victoria Street, Church Street and Davison Street. The draft DDO also encourages for improved pedestrian connections or linkages from the Yarra River/Birrarung.

It also aims to make sure new development minimises its amenity impacts on the low scale residential neighbourhoods which abut the Precinct. This includes minimising overlooking, overshadowing and visual bulk.
